Summary

Poseidon is the Greco-Roman god of the sea, earthquakes, and storms and the elder brother of Zeus. He is referred to as one of the Big Three, the three most powerful Greek Gods, and is the father of Perseus Jackson, whom he conceived with a mortal in violation of the treaty made decades ago after the end of World War II. As such he is rarely present in Percy's life, but does his best to observe and support his demigod son.

Notable Attacks/Techniques:

  • Water Manipulation: Poseidon has absolute control over water and can use it in a various of ways, even creating water from nothing. He can unleash gigantic tsunamis, tidal waves and create gigantic water funnel clouds. Overall he has the same hydrokinetic powers as Percy, only to a more infinite and vastly superior level.
  • Earth Manipulation: Also known as the "Earthshaker" and god of earthquakes, poseidon has the ability to generate earthquakes.
  • Weather Manipulation: Due to his control of the weather over the seas, Poseidon is also known as the God of Storms, being able to create fierce hurricanes as well as clear skies for sailors as he wished to.
  • Aquatic Lordship: Poseidon has absolute control and divine authority over all sea creatures, as well as many fearsome monsters native to the sea.
  • True Form: Like the rest of the Greek Gods, Poseidon possesses a "True Form" that manifests when he gathers all of his essence in one place. During this time, he emits blinding, searing light that is able to kill any mortal foolish enough to challenge him virtually instantly and vaporizing the physical forms of those who survive an initial glance.
  • Transfiguration: Poseidon is able to transmute and transfigure virtually anything into anything else with ease, for example transforming a seamonster as big as a gym into millions of goldfishes.
